Abstract

THe herbicide composite contains compound A and at least one of sulfonylurea, triazabenzene, benzoic acid, pyridazinone, nitrile, pyridine, sulfamide, carbamide, amide, imide herbicide, etc. The compound A is nicosulfuron and is named chemical 2-(4,6-methoxypyrimidyl-2-amino formly chloro sulfuryl)-N,N-dimethyl nicotinamide.

Nicosulfuron herbicide composition
The present invention relates to the herbicidal composition of nicosulfuron and sulfonylurea, triazine, benzoic acids, pyridazinone, nitrile, pyridines, organic heterocyclic class, sulfonamides, three ketones, ureas, triazolineone, isoxazole ketone, amide-type, acid imide, class virtue oxanamide class, amino ureas, phenoxy carboxylic acid, dinitroaniline composition.
At present, corn field herbicide mainly is based on closed soil, and herbicide after seedling is very few.Corn field the second grade complex preparation commonly used carries out the preceding closed soil treatment of seedling, and its herbicidal effect and soil moisture are in close relations, and soil moisture content is bad, and its preventive effect is just had a greatly reduced quality.And ten spring nine of the weather drought of China, spring drought has reduced more than 15% the preventive effect of this class medicament, and nicosulfuron is a herbicides special behind the corn field seedling, and grassy weed in the corn field and part broad leaved weed are had significant preventive effect, and corn is had very high safety.Because nicosulfuron is mainly active high to grassy weed, good to part broad leaved weed activity, if again with sulfonylurea, triazine, benzoic acids, pyridazinone, nitrile, pyridines, the organic heterocyclic class, sulfonamides, three ketones, ureas, triazolineone, the isoxazole ketone, amide-type, acid imide, class virtue oxanamide class, amino ureas, phenoxy carboxylic acid, the mixture of herbicides of dinitroaniline becomes preparation, they can enlarge kills the grass spectrum, improve herbicidal effect, reduce residual activity, reduction is to the poisoning of crop, delay the drug-fast generation of weeds and the succession of community, reduce dosage, reduce environmental pollution; Laborsaving simultaneously, economical, reduce farmer's burdens.

For composition of the present invention, above listed weed killer herbicide the best be cyanazine, Pendimethalin, pyridate, Brominal, Bentazon, metribuzin, metobenzuron, diflufenzopyr, sulphur humulone.
Composition of the present invention can be two combinations, also can be the composition that aforesaid compound forms more than two kinds.
The mechanism of action difference of the various compositions of composition of the present invention, mutually synergy between them, the pesticide resistance of weeds reduces, so the herbicidal effect of composition is obviously high slightly or the suitable herbicidal effect of single time spent of each component, and kills the grass spectrum and broadens.
Composition of the present invention is mainly used in corn field, mainly prevents and kill off upland field weeds such as lady's-grass, green foxtail, wild oat, salsola collina, Amaranthus retroflexus, acalypha copperleaf, kitchen garden, black nightshade, multitude, Siberian cocklebur, meadow pine, chickweed.
Nicosulfuron and sulfonylurea, triazine, benzoic acids, pyridazinone, nitrile, pyridines, organic heterocyclic class, sulfonamides, three ketones, ureas, triazolineone, isoxazole ketone, amide-type, acid imide, class virtue oxanamide class, amino ureas, phenoxy carboxylic acid, dinitroaniline weeding ratio are 1: 160 to 80: 1 based on the parts by weight of active component in the present composition, optimal proportion 1: 40 to 40: 1.
Composition of the present invention can also comprise emulsifier, solvent, auxiliary agent, filler, oils (vegetable oil, mineral oil) etc., and the parts by weight of its shared composition are 0.5%~95%.
The best preparation of composition of the present invention has: oil-suspending agent, aqueous suspension agent, suspension emulsion, aqua, also can be other formulations such as missible oil, pulvis, dust agent, granula, microemulsion, wetting powder, dry suspending agent, sustained release agent, water dispersible granules and granule.
Composition of the present invention also will add surface reactive materials such as emulsifier, dispersant, wetting agent, to increase stability, wetability, the permeability of composition.
The product that the present invention describes can be the finished product preparation form, and promptly material mixes in the product.Yet the composition of composition also can provide with preparation separately, directly mixes in jar before use.
Composition of the present invention can use by common method, as spraying.
